ByteCookRelearning Java: What Principles Are Dynamic Proxies Based On?Programming languages can be categorized from various perspectives, with dynamic typing and static typing being one such perspective. The…9h ago9h ago
ByteCookFirewalls: How To Draw the Line With HackersWhen hackers launch a network attack, the first step is often to scan the system for open ports and attempt to connect or exploit them. For…9h ago9h ago
ByteCookIn-Depth Analysis of the Basic Concepts of Pod Objects in KubernetesIn Kubernetes, Pods, not containers, are the smallest schedulable units. This design is reflected in the API objects, where containers…1d ago1d ago
ByteCookIntroduction to the Handler Components in JettyThe design of Jetty’s Handler is quite fascinating and can be considered the essence of Jetty. Jetty achieves high levels of customization…1d ago1d ago
ByteCookinLevel Up CodingPython Coding Standards I Learned From GoogleMany visitors to Google, after using the restroom, are often surprised and somewhat embarrassed to ask, “Is the Python style guide posted…2d ago2d ago
ByteCookWhy Do We Need Pods in Kubernetes?In Kubernetes, a Pod is the smallest API object. To put it more professionally, a Pod is the atomic scheduling unit in Kubernetes.2d ago2d ago
ByteCookRelearning Java: What Are the Differences Between String, StringBuffer, and StringBuilder?Today, I will discuss strings, which might seem simple at first glance but are actually a special concept in almost every programming…2d ago2d ago
ByteCookHow To Achieve Efficient Remote Procedure Calls With gRPCToday, we’ll use a practical example to explore how gRPC encodes structured messages into network packets based on the HTTP/2 and ProtoBuf…3d ago3d ago
ByteCookRelearning Java: What Are the Differences Between Strong References, Soft References, Weak…In Java, apart from primitive data types, everything else is considered a reference type, pointing to various objects. Understanding…4d ago4d ago
ByteCookRelearning Java: What Are the Differences Between Final, Finally, and Finalize?Java has many seemingly similar language elements that serve completely different purposes, and these elements often become focal points…5d ago5d ago